§ 29708 County Employee Claim Restrictions

Key Takeaways

  • •County workers can't ask for money or special favors from the county for themselves, unless it's part of their job.
  • •They also can't help someone else get money or special favors from the county, unless it's their official duty.
  • •This rule is to stop people from using their job to get unfair benefits.

Example

A county worker helps their friend get extra money from the county for a project.

This is not allowed unless helping friends is part of their job. They can get in trouble for doing this.

§ 29708 County Employee Claim Restrictions

Except for his own service, no county officer or employee may present any claim for allowance against the county. No county officer or employee may in any way, except in the discharge of his official duty, advocate the relief asked in a claim made by any other person. (Added by renumbering Section 29718 by Stats. 1959, Ch. 1725.)
